Situated in Daytona Beach, FL, the Orlando VA Rehabilitation Center provides a wide range of treatment options for adults and children struggling with substance use and co-occurring mental health disorders. The center emphasizes intensive outpatient and outpatient services, catering specifically to adult men, women, and those who have faced domestic violence. Their treatment methods incorporate anger management, cognitive behavioral therapy, and brief interventions. This facility is dedicated to serving adults and seniors of all genders, offering top-notch, personalized care to assist individuals on their path toward recovery.

| Type of Care | Substance use treatment, Treatment for co-occurring substance use plus either serious mental health illness in adults/serious emotional disturbance in children |
| Service Settings | Intensive outpatient treatment, Outpatient, Outpatient methadone/buprenorphine or naltrexone treatment, Regular outpatient treatment |
| Medications Offered | Buprenorphine used in Treatment, Naltrexone used in Treatment |
